Certification
The main raw material that makes up our toys is melamine plywood of the highest quality.
The types of plywood on the market are huge, so it took us a very long time to find the one that would meet all our criteria and the safety criteria of the EU Directive.
What guided our selection?
First of all, the quality and method of production. The material we use is produced in Poland with respect for the forest environment, animals, plants and people. It has a low carbon footprint and is ethically produced.
It was very important to us that this be confirmed by relevant tests, and so the raw material is certified by the Forest Stewardship Council® (FSC) and the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ification (PEFC).These are the largest international certification programs in the timber industry.
The FSC is the most credible forest resource certification system in existence in the world today, and is the only one endorsed by major environmental organizations and numerous indigenous communities.
PEFC’s “Chain of Custody of Forest-based Products” allows verification of the origin of wood at each stage of its processing and flow
EU Directives and CE(Conformité Européenne).
The material we use has extremely low formaldehyde emissions and meets the standards of the EU Directive. It was tested in a laboratory, the tests showed emissions at a level not exceeding the E1 standard.
It also meets other harmonized standards such as:
EN 71-1: Mechanical and physical properties
EN 71-2: Flammability
EN 71-3: Specification for the migration of certain chemical elements
The EN71 standards are also met by the varnishes, paints and oils we use to protect toys.
Water-based varnishes are 100% safe for children, we use varnishes of European origin, the largest reputable companies that have the appropriate tests and certificates.
The oils, which are a blend of natural oils and waxes, are approved for food contact thus are also 100% safe for children.
CE markings placed on the product are a declaration that the marked product complies with the requirements of the directives of the so-called “CE” directives. “New Approach” of the European Union (EU) and was subjected to a detailed conformity assessment study.

OEKO- TEX ®
All the textiles we use are certified by OEKO-TEX ® standard 100, which is one of the world’s best-known certificates for textiles tested for harmful substances.
Means high product safety and customer confidence.
Laces, furniture upholstery or linen pouches are just details, but we even took care of them!
